Aloo posto
#anniversari ALOO POSTO is the traditional Bengali dish originally from West Bengal but equally appropriate by Bengali from the eastern part as well . In this dish potatoes are fried in a thick coating of poppy seeds or POSTO and tastes really great .....
Steps
- 1
Add oil into a deep pan add kalonji seeds and potato cubs.
- 2
Stir the potatoes and fry them for 8 - 10 minutes on medium heat.
- 3
Meanwhile add salt, sugar and chilli paste and stir well.
- 4
When the potatoes are half done add the POSTO paste and mix with the potatoes very well.
- 5
After 4 - 5 minutes add 1/4 cup of water. Stir and cover the pan with a lid and cook in slow flame.
- 6
Check after 5 minutes. Add 1/2 cup more water and again cover with a lid.
- 7
Once the aloo is soft and fluffy cooked and dry up stir the aloo without mashing them or breaking them.
- 8
Put off the flame and serve hot.
